This complete Wolf WK-101 air conditioning and ventilation system includes a supply air unit, extract air unit, and heater—designed to handle high-volume air processing for industrial facilities. The supply unit delivers 8,500 m³/h with a 3kW motor, while the extract unit features four F5-class filters for effective air purification. Together, they maintain controlled temperature and air quality across large spaces like manufacturing plants, chemical facilities, warehouses, and cleanrooms.
Industries & Uses
Chemical plants, pharmaceutical companies, food processing facilities, and industrial manufacturers rely on systems like this to protect product quality, ensure worker safety, and meet environmental regulations. The dual-unit design allows simultaneous fresh air intake and contaminated air removal, essential for processes sensitive to dust, humidity, or airborne particles.
What to Check When Buying
When evaluating this 2008 system, request complete maintenance records and filter replacement history—frequent filter changes indicate proper upkeep. Inspect motors and fan blades for corrosion or imbalance, check seals for leaks, and verify electrical connections. Ask about operating hours and any repairs performed. Given the system's age, budget for potential motor servicing and filter stock. Confirm all three components (supply, extract, heater) operate together as a coordinated unit before purchase.
